Bhopal, June 15 -- As Bhopal celebrates Father's Day, bakeries frost cakes, children queue outside gift shops, and social media floods with tributes. Ties, pens and keychains are wrapped with care. Restaurants prepare "Father's Day Special" tables. Love and reverence hang in the summer air - at least outwardly.

But for some families, the day brings no celebration. Just silence. Grief. Unresolved rage. In homes torn by addiction, violence or mental illness, the loving father figure is not absent - he is feared. And in rare, horrific cases, he is the killer. Or the victim.
